Breathtaking sights - This is a great trip. The guide Серж was super helpful, easy going and had plenty of fun stories and interesting historical information to share with the group. This really was excellent value for money and the views are breathtaking. My own negative point - and this is not directed at the tour - is about the treatment of the horses for hire at Kaindy Lake. I noticed the horse I was to be given had a deep laceration due to the saddle being ill fitted. It was a fresh wound and clearly would have been causing the horse pain. I pointed this out and swapped horses. Within two minutes the owner was giving the horse to another person. Clearly no care for the animal nor the safety issue of the rider who could have been bucked by a horse in pain. DO NOT HIRE THESE HORSES. The company have been informed.

Beautiful Lakes and Gorgeous Canyons - The lakes and canyons view are excellent. We hiked a lot in this two days trip. We tried local horse meat in this trip. Horse meat is similar with beaf. The experience of sleeping in a yurt is special. It's cold in a yurt at night. We feel much warmer when the heater works at night.
